It's funny how people will always fall for a cheap way of what they think might make more power.

In truth.. if more "free power" could have been had the OEMs, they would have decreased displacement & done it years ago.

Without a doubt the most effecient way to boost daily driving power is a turbo. And that also requires remapping of timing and fuel.

It's not cheap and never will be.
